Alarm won't go off


I have an autostart/alarm thing on my car, whatever you call it...it locks, unlocks, starts and stops the car, but for some reason the alarm doesn't go off anymore when you try to open the door when its locked. I think this may have started happening after I left my lights on and killed my battery, I'm not sure though.
Is there any way to reset an alarm system or something? just something to make it act normal again...

When you hit the lock and unlock button does it chirp at all or your horn honks? Is your led blinking or constant when you arm the car? If it doesnt chirp or the LED is constant then the alarm might have went into valet mode. What brand do you have?

who installed it? i would take it back to them so that they can check it out. There is no program for door triggers. Even if the battery died it will still work, the only other thing that I can think of is that somehow during the whole battery dying and changing that your door trigger went bad (which I dont see how it would) but it could be a possibility.

Alarms systems dont have resets. You have to actually program all the functions into the brain and then the only way to reset it is to program it manually reset it via the valet switch.
